Class 37 covers construction services, repair and maintenance of buildings and equipment. Contractors, repair shops, and installation services file here.
What Class 37 Covers
Class 37 includes building construction, repair, installation services, and maintenance.
The class covers:
- Construction - Building construction, renovation
- Repair services - Appliance, vehicle, computer repair
- Installation - HVAC, electrical, plumbing installation
- Maintenance - Building maintenance, cleaning, landscaping

NOT Included in Class 37
These similar items belong in other classes:
- Architectural services - Class 42 (Technology Services)
- Building materials - Class 19 (Building Materials)
- Real estate development - Class 36 (Financial Services)
- Interior design services - Class 42 (Technology Services)
Common Services Descriptions
Using pre-approved descriptions from the USPTO Trademark ID Manual avoids the $200 custom description surcharge.
Popular pre-approved descriptions for Class 37:
- Building construction
- Repair services
- Installation services
- Maintenance services
- Cleaning services
- Vehicle repair
- Computer repair

Filing Tips for Class 37
Repair vs. Parts
Class 37 covers the repair service, not replacement parts:
| What You Offer | Class |
|---|---|
| Vehicle repair service | Class 37 |
| Vehicle parts | Class 12 |
| Computer repair | Class 37 |
| Computer parts | Class 9 |
Construction vs. Architecture
Design and construction are different classes:
| Service | Class |
|---|---|
| Building construction | Class 37 |
| Architectural design | Class 42 |
| Interior design | Class 42 |
Specimens for Repair Services
For Class 37 trademarks, acceptable specimens include:
- Website showing services offered
- Service vehicles with mark
- Invoices and estimates
- Advertising materials

Filing Fees
Current USPTO fees for Class 37 trademark applications (2025):
| Filing Type | Fee per Class |
|---|---|
| Electronic filing (ID Manual description) | $350 |
| Electronic filing (custom description) | $550 |
| Paper filing | $1,000 |
